HE Public Health Minister Hails HH the Emir's Patronizing the Opening of Cuban Hospital

Doha, January 10 (QNA) - HE Public Health Minister Abdullah Bin Khalid Al Qahtani who is also secretary general of the Supreme Council Of Health (SCH) has underlined that the patronizing and attendance of HH the emir sheikh hamad bin Khalifa Al Thani the inauguration ceremony of the cuban hospital in dukhan reflects HH the emir's constant keenness to follow up the major achievements of the development process HIS Highness leads with capability in all walks of life in qatar. In an opening address he delivered on the occasion of the inauguration of the cuban hospital in Dukhan , HE Al Qahtani has highlighted the close relations binding together Qatar and Cuba ...''Today forms a unique day for the State of Qatar and the Republic of Cuba which are enjoying close ties of joint cooperation and reciprocal respect,'' said the Public Health Minister Abdullah Bin Khalid Al Qahtani. HE the minister welcomed the specialized cuban medical cadres totaling more than 200 persons... We are waiting for these cadres ‘contributions to provide highly qualitative and advanced medical care service to our patients, said the minister. The name of Dukhan hospital was changed last November to become the Cuban hospital in recognition of the special and distinguished ties of partnership existing between the two countries , Qatar and Cuba and a reference to the specialized clinical services provided by the friendly Republic of Cuba in this hospital. Referring to the wide reputation Cuba enjoys worldwide in the field of health care systems , HE Abdullah Bin Khalid Al Qahtani said Cuba is one of the most advanced countries worldwide in this field and of the leading countries as far as health care concept focusing on patient is concerned and is exporting its medical expertise to several world countries. Elaborating HE Abdullah Al-Qahtani said that there are about 40,000 Cuban medical personnel working in more than 68 world countries as they are now transferring their unique experience to Qatar. The newly opened Cuba Hospital is a modern therapeutic facility designed to make it capable of meeting the current needs of the population of the western region of the country and which is witnessing steady growth population, but it would also has the ability to expand health services in the future to become a center to support the integrated health care, in addition to the health prevention activities and health education . HE Public Health Minister Abdullah Bin Khalid Al Qahtani who is also secretary general of the Supreme Council Of Health (SCH) also pointed out that the Cuban hospital setting under the umbrella of the Hamad Medical Corporation, the main provider of treatment services in the state, will benefit all patients from its services, "as it ensures the best levels of care treatment according to international standards". HE Public Health Minister meantime stressed that this is consistent with the quality of integrated health services system in the Hamad Medical Corporation based focusing on the patient, and through which it won the highest international certification in the field of quality of medical care. Abdullah Bin Khalid Al Qahtani underlined that these experiences if mixed with modern techniques and the support that can be provided by the State of Qatar , it would yield fruit in the form of a unique world-class experience, that benefit the patients in the state and specially the residents of the western region of the country and which is experiencing steady population growth. It is noteworthy that the State of Qatar has built and equipped the state of-the-art hospital whereas the Cuban government provided it with more than two hundred people from the highly qualified medical staff , including doctors, nurses and specialists in the areas of rehabilitation, dental and pathology and engineering of bio-medical and X-ray. The hospital Cuban is a modern facility which was not only designed to meet the current needs of the population and workforce, but also to enable expansion to provide more services to the largest number of patients, making it an important focal point to support the integration of health care services as well as prevention activities and health education to residents of the western regions of the State of of Qatar. It was to be noted that in the middle of last year, the outpatient clinics were opened at the hospital to provide laboratory services, radiology and pharmacy. (QNA)
